We get to see live volcanoes up close!

Did you know that the town where we will probably be staying is very close to a live volcano named Arenal? There are 4 active volcanoes in Costa Rica. I think the prospect of seeing a volcano up close is REALLY COOL! In one thing I read, it said that on a clear night you can see the volcano flaring up and even see molten lava at times! Apparently it is a real tourist attraction. The town is called La Fortuna de San Carlos or La Fortuna for short. I can't wait to see my first volcano with y'all! See ya!
